Output e676220aa3525eaff20028bfb324c3ae66fbd2c53ae4e367e21a7f4c34bd8754:0

value
670429
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e06315bc89c1242b13cdd28b1adfdd7e9bdf2319 OP_EQUAL
address
3N9Tz45Vpo6RnTTRFwnSHvi5Tc9vmYNCnn
transaction
e676220aa3525eaff20028bfb324c3ae66fbd2c53ae4e367e21a7f4c34bd8754
spent
true